Convert Line to Tesla Square Meter

Conversion Formula for Line to Tesla Square Meter

The formula of conversion of Line to Tesla Square Meter is very simple. To convert Line to Tesla Square Meter, we can use this simple formula:

1 Line = 0.00000001 Tesla Square Meter

1 Tesla Square Meter = 100,000,000 Line

One Line is equal to 0.00000001 Tesla Square Meter. So, we need to multiply the number of Line by 0.00000001 to get the no of Tesla Square Meter. This formula helps when we need to change the measurements from Line to Tesla Square Meter

Details for Line (CGS Flux Unit)

Introduction : The line represents the basic CGS unit of magnetic flux, equivalent to one maxwell. This small unit was historically important for measuring weak magnetic fields and remains relevant for understanding older scientific literature and certain specialized applications.

History & Origin : Originated in 19th century electromagnetic research as part of the centimeter-gram-second system. The term 'line' reflects early concepts of magnetic flux as lines of force, popularized by Faraday's experimental visualizations.

Current Use : Mainly used for interpreting historical data and in some material science research. Occasionally appears in geomagnetism studies and specialized engineering contexts where CGS units persist.

Details for Tesla Square Meter (Alternative SI Unit)

Introduction : This unit directly expresses magnetic flux as the product of magnetic flux density (tesla) and area (square meters). It provides an intuitive physical interpretation of flux measurement, particularly useful in electromagnetic design and magnetic material characterization.

History & Origin : Developed as an alternative SI formulation to emphasize the fundamental definition of magnetic flux. Gained prominence in late 20th century with increased focus on precise physical interpretations of units.

Current Use : Common in physics research, particularly when measuring flux through known areas. Useful for calculating flux in solenoids, electromagnets, and when working with magnetic materials of defined dimensions.
